Malayan Bread

  • Recipe Submitted by on

Category: Breads

 Ingredients List

  • 2 c Flour
  • 1 ts Salt
  • 1 lg Egg, Beaten
  • Water For Mixing
  • Melted Mutton Fat

 Directions

Yield: 4 To 5 Breads Cooking Time: 10 To 12 Minutes

Sieve the flour and salt onto a pastry board or table. Make a hollow in the
center and pour in the beaten egg. Add a little cold water and mix to a
stiff dough. Knead for several minutes. Divide the dough into 3 pieces,
roll each out very thinly. Spread the dough with the melted mutton fat.
Pull the dough out by hand until it is paper thin. Gather up the outside
ends and knead all together again. Roll to a very long thin strip. Gather
the dough up on one end and roll the strip up. Roll it out thinly and cut
out circles 6-inches in diameter. Heat fat in a frying pan and fry the
bread on both sides.

From How To Make Good Curries by Helen Lawson Copyright 1973
